2023-02267, 2023-06457 The People, etc., appellant, v Jason Johnson, respondent. (Ind. No. 71331/2022)
| DECISION & ORDER ON MOTION |
Appeals from two orders of the Supreme Court, Nassau County, dated December 21, 2022, and July 5, 2023, respectively. Motion by the respondent's retained counsel for leave to withdraw as counsel and to stay all proceedings for a period of 90 days.
Upon the papers filed in support of the motion and the papers filed in relation thereto, it is
ORDERED that the branch of the motion which is for leave to withdraw as counsel
is granted and on or before April 15, 2024, retained counsel shall serve its client by one of the methods specified in CPLR 2103(c), with a copy of this decision and order on motion and shall file proof of such service with the Clerk of this Court; and it is further,
ORDERED that the branch of the motion which is to stay all proceedings for a period of 90 days is granted to the extent that no further proceedings shall be taken against the respondent, without leave of this Court, until the expiration of 30 days after service upon him of a copy of this decision and order on motion; and it is further,
ORDERED that on the Court's own motion, the respondent's time to serve and file a brief is extended, on or before June 14, 2024, the respondent shall serve and file the respondent's brief via NYSCEF, if applicable, or, if NYSCEF is not mandated, serve the brief and upload a digital copy of the brief, with proof of service thereof, through the digital portal on this Court's website.
